Distilled in 1965 and matured in a sherry butt before release in 2010 as part of the Glenfarclas Family Cask collection. This is a heathery, sweet and toffee like whisky. This was aged in cask number 4362, which had an outturn of 440 bottles.
Spicy, dark sugar, feinty. Soft leather. rubber. Nutty. Potpourri, earthen.
Rich, spicy. Honey, liquorice, menthol. Muscovado.
Fresh, crisp, developing oak.
